About the role (Alexandria, VA)

Begin your driving career in the Washington, D.C. metro area with a role designed for newly licensed CDL-A holders. 365 Freight USA is hiring recent graduates and new CDL-A drivers for a paid 4–6 week mentor training program based in Alexandria, VA. During training you will ride with and learn from an experienced driver, develop practical on-road skills, and transition into solo driving. After training, drivers can earn $1,600–$1,800 weekly with full benefits.

What we offer

  • Paid mentor training throughout the 4–6 week program.
  • Weekly pay via direct deposit.
  • After training, expected weekly earnings of $1,600–$1,800.
  • Access to full employee benefits following completion of training.
  • Structured, practical on-the-road mentorship to help new drivers build confidence and safe driving experience.

What you'll be doing

  • Complete a paid 4–6 week mentor training period, learning day-to-day professional trucking routines and preparing to transition into solo driving.
  • Ride with an experienced mentor driver, assist with pickups and deliveries, and learn safe, efficient load handling.
  • Follow safe driving practices, perform required vehicle and log checks, and cultivate professional habits for long-haul operations.
  • Gain hands-on experience with trip flow, communication with dispatch and team members, and decision-making as you progress to independent driving.

What we're looking for

  • Recent CDL-A graduates or newly licensed CDL-A drivers ready to begin professional driving.
  • Safety-first mindset: adherence to DOT regulations, company procedures, and established safe driving practices at all times.
  • Reliability: consistent attendance, punctuality, and the ability to meet schedule and training responsibilities.
  • Coachability: openness to feedback and willingness to learn through on-road instruction from a mentor.
  • Strong communication: clear and timely communication with your mentor, dispatch, and other team members.
